Hello officers of Habitat for Humanity,

Your group will be receiving a private bulletin board for the next two
years (valid for 2013 and 2014). You will be receiving board 17E. This is
the same board you had previously.

Your board will be in one of three states:
1. You are keeping your old board. Congratulations! This is not much you
need to do, but see below.

2. You are moving to a board which is already cleared. Feel free to move in
any time.

3. You are moving to a board which is not yet cleared. We ask that you be
patient - currently occupied boards must be cleared by Feb 6th at 11:59 pm.
Feel free to move in starting on the 7th.

Regardless of which category you are in, you have until Feb 15th to put up
a board. If this is not enough, feel free to email asa-boards and ask for
more time.

All boards must comply with the rules on our website (
web.mit.edu/asa/resources/bulletin-board-alloc.html). In short, you mut
keep your board filled (usually with a background), include your group name
and contact info, include information about your group and its activities,
keep your board updated, and maintain the condition of its materials.

If you are no longer interested in having a private board, please let us
know by emailing asa-boards at mit.edu as soon as possible.
